Neck Pain That Keeps Coming Back Has a Root Cause

Neck pain is one of the most common complaints we see, and one of the most frequently undertreated. Most people get some massage, do a few chin tucks, maybe try a chiropractor, and feel better temporarily. Then it comes back.

 

That cycle happens because the neck is usually not the problem. It's the result of one.

 

Your cervical spine sits at the top of a system. When the thoracic spine is stiff, when the shoulders aren't moving well, or when how you load and carry your body is off, the neck compensates. Over time, that compensation becomes pain.

Why Neck Pain Treatment Often Misses the Mark

If you've dealt with chronic or recurring neck pain, you've probably been told to stretch your neck, strengthen it, improve your posture, and get a better pillow. None of that addresses the underlying system.

 

Common root causes of neck pain that go unaddressed:

 

  • Thoracic spine stiffness forcing the cervical spine to compensate for lack of mobility

  • Poor scapular control creating excessive tension at the base of the neck

  • Upper trap and levator dominance from shoulder mechanics that are off

  • Forward head posture driven by thoracic kyphosis, not just "bad habits"

  • Movement dysfunction that has built up over years of compensation

 

When the real driver is corrected, the neck finally gets the relief it can't achieve on its own.

Neck Conditions We Commonly Treat

Cervical stiffness and limited range of motion: difficulty turning your head, chronic tightness, or morning stiffness that limits daily activity

Cervicogenic headaches: headaches that originate from the neck, often felt at the base of the skull or radiating into the head

 

Neck pain from desk work or prolonged sitting: pain and tension that builds through the workday from sustained postures

 

Cervical radiculopathy: nerve-related pain, numbness, or tingling that radiates from the neck into the shoulder, arm, or hand

 

Whiplash and post-traumatic neck pain: pain and stiffness following a motor vehicle accident or sudden impact

 

Tech neck: chronic neck and upper back tension from prolonged forward head posture with screens and devices

 

Post-surgical cervical rehab: returning to full function after cervical fusion, disc surgery, or other neck procedures

 

Chronic neck pain that hasn't resolved: if previous treatment provided only temporary relief, the root cause hasn't been found yet
